PENERAPAN ALGORITMA CAST-128 PADA PROSES ENKRIPSI DAN DEKRIPSI TEKS

Authors

  • Cut Armida Adhana Universitas Malikussaleh, Indonesia Author
  • Rafli Universitas Malikussaleh, Indonesia Author
  • M.Zikri Febriansyah Universitas Malikussaleh, Indonesia Author
  • Mhd Yudya Ananda Hasibuan Universitas Malikussaleh, Indonesia Author
  • Mhd Sanjay Sitepu Universitas Malikussaleh, Indonesia Author
  • Hesty Sisya Olivia Universitas Malikussaleh, Indonesia Author
  • Aulia Ramadhan Hasibuan Universitas Malikussaleh, Indonesia Author
  • Zahrul Laina Universitas Malikussaleh, Indonesia Author

DOI:

https://doi.org/10.62671/suliwa.v2i1.54

Keywords:

Penerapan, Enkripsi, Dekripsi, teks dan Algoritma CAST-128

Abstract

Penyandian yang pertama kali dibuat dengan menggunakan algoritma clasic. algoritma ini menumpukan keamanannya pada kerahasian algoritma yang digunakan. Namun algoritma ini tidak efisien saat digunakan untuk berkomunikasi dengan banyak orang karena algoritmanya masih sangat sederhana dan masih sangat mudah untuk dipecahkan, sehingga informasi atau data penting yang ingin dirahasiakan dengan mudah dapat diketehui orang lain atau orang yang tidak bertanggungjawab. CAST-128 adalah sebuah algoritma kriptografi yang dikatakan mirip dengan algoritma DES dimana menggunakan 16 putaran jaringan feistel sebagai salah satu kekuatannya. Dimana pada proses enkripsi dan dekripsi teks CAST-128 menggunakan panjang blok 64 bit dan panjang kunci sampai 128 bit. Sebagai informasi, algoritma CAST-128 ini disebut sebagai salah satu algoritma kriptografi yang kuat terhadap berbagai macam kriptanalisis, termasuk differential dan linear attack. Dengan adanya penerapan algoritma CAST- 128 dalam proses enkripsi dan dekripsi teks akan lebih sulit untuk dipecahkan teks yang disandikan oleh orang-orang yang tidak mengetahui kuncinya sehingga dapat menciptakan keamanan yang lebih dari teks yang telah disandikan. Jadi ketika teks tersebut ingin dikirim atau dipindahkan ke flashdisk akan lebih terjaga kerahasiaannya.

References

D. Ariyus, “Kriptografi keamanan data dan komunikasi,” Yogyakarta Graha Ilmu, 2006.

M. Qamal, “Kriptografi File Citra Menggunakan Algoritma Tea (Tiny Encryption Algorithm),” TECHSI - J. Penelit. Tek. Inform., 2014.

R. Munir, “Kriptografi,” Inform. Bandung, 2006.

J. Simarmata et al., “Implementation of AES Algorithm for information security of web-based application,” Int. J. Eng. Technol., vol. 7, no. 3.4 Special Issue 4, 2018.

T. Limbong et al., “The implementation of computer based instruction model on Gost Algorithm Cryptography Learning,” in IOP Conference Series: Materials Science and Engineering, 2018, vol. 420, no. 1, p. 12094.

Z. Hercigonja, “Comparative Analysis of Cryptographic Algorithms,” Int.

J. Digit. Technol. Econ., vol. 1, no. 2, pp. 127–134, 2016.

G. N. Krishnamurthy, “Encryption Quality Analysis and Security Evaluation of CAST-128 Algorithm and its Modified Version using Digital Images,” Netw. Secur., vol. 1, no. 1, pp. 28–33, 2009.

Downloads

Published

2025-05-28

How to Cite

PENERAPAN ALGORITMA CAST-128 PADA PROSES ENKRIPSI DAN DEKRIPSI TEKS. (2025). SULIWA: Jurnal Multidisiplin Teknik, Sains, Pendidikan dan Teknologi, 2(1), 23-30. https://doi.org/10.62671/suliwa.v2i1.54

How to Cite

PENERAPAN ALGORITMA CAST-128 PADA PROSES ENKRIPSI DAN DEKRIPSI TEKS. (2025). SULIWA: Jurnal Multidisiplin Teknik, Sains, Pendidikan dan Teknologi, 2(1), 23-30. https://doi.org/10.62671/suliwa.v2i1.54